DescriptionJoin our dynamic Other Hardlines (OHL) Instock Management team as an Individual Contributor, where you'll play a critical role in ensuring product availability and driving customer satisfaction across our fastest-growing categories. This position offers the opportunity to work with inventory systems, collaborate with cross-functional teams, and directly impact millions of customer experiences daily.As an Instock Manager for OHL, you'll be responsible for maintaining optimal inventory levels across diverse product categories including home improvement, tools, automotive, and sporting goods. - Monitor and analyze inventory health metrics across assigned Hardlines categories, identifying out-of-stock risks, excess inventory situations, and supply chain disruptions that impact product availability- Generate and distribute daily/weekly performance reports tracking key instock metrics (in-stock rate, coverage days, aged inventory) and provide actionable insights to stakeholders- Support root cause analysis for availability issues by investigating vendor performance, demand forecast accuracy, purchase order status, and fulfillment center constraints
- Collaborate with vendors and supply chain partners to expedite critical purchase orders, resolve receiving delays, and ensure timely replenishment of fast-moving items
- Maintain and update inventory planning tools including demand forecasts, safety stock parameters, and reorder points based on sales trends and seasonality patterns- Conduct ad-hoc data analysis to support business decisions, such as evaluating new vendor onboarding opportunities, assessing promotional impact on inventory, or identifying slow-moving SKUs for clearance- Participate in cross-functional meetings with retail buyers, operations teams, and finance to align on inventory strategies and communicate instock performance- Create and maintain documentation of standard operating procedures, escalation protocols, and best practices for inventory management processes- Support system testing and implementation of new inventory management tools, providing feedback on functionality and user experience- Track and report on vendor compliance metrics including on-time delivery rates, fill rates, and lead time performance to drive continuous improvementBasic Qualifications- Experience in data analytics or automation
